Optical speculum
A system for direct imaging and diagnosing of abnormal cells in a target tissue includes a disposable optical speculum and an image acquisition system having the speculum assembled on and mechanically secured thereto. The image acquisition system is arranged to capture at least one of a single image or multiple images or video of cells within the target tissue using at least one of bright field or dark field ring illumination divided into independently operated segments to obtain a plurality of data sets. An image analysis and control unit in communication with the image acquisition system analyzes the data sets and applies algorithms to the data sets for diagnosing abnormal cells.
Melanin Ablation Guided by Stepwise Multi-Photon Activated Fluorescence
A method and system of ablating melanin are provided. Stepwise multi-photon fluorescence is induced in melanin within a region of tissue. The fluorescence is detected, and at least a portion of the melanin from which the fluorescence is detected is ablated. The system and method can use a continuous wave laser in the near infrared range for the inducement and ablation of melanin, providing high resolution at low cost.
HANDPIECE WITH A MICROCHIP LASER
A microchip laser and a handpiece including the microchip laser. The microchip laser includes a laser medium with input and output facets. The input facet is coated with a highly reflective dielectric coating at microchip laser wavelength and highly transmissive at pump wavelength. The output facet is coated with a partially reflective at microchip laser wavelength dielectric coating. A saturable absorber attached by intermolecular forces to output facet of microchip laser. A handpiece for skin treatment includes the microchip laser.

LASER TREATMENT APPARATUS AND METHOD FOR CONTROLLING THE SAME
A laser treatment apparatus includes an irradiation system, a wavefront changing unit, and a controller. The irradiation system is configured to output laser light for treatment from a light source. The wavefront changing unit is configured to change a wave front of the laser light for treatment output by the irradiation system to guide the laser light for treatment whose wave front is changed to a patient's eye. The controller is configured to control the wavefront changing unit.

System and method for tissue treatment
A cooling element includes a frame including one or more datums. The cooling element also includes a first window including a first proximal surface and a first distal surface. The first window is sealed to the frame. The cooling element further includes a second window sealed to the frame. The second window includes a second proximal surface and a second distal surface. The second window is configured to contact a target tissue or a tissue adjacent to the target tissue via the second distal surface. The cooing element also includes a coolant chamber located between the first distal surface of the first window and the second proximal surface of the second window and configured to receive a coolant. The first window, the second window and the coolant chamber are configured to receive and electromagnetic radiation (EMR), and transmit a portion of the received EMR to the target tissue.
METHODS AND SYSTEMS FOR BLOCKING NEURAL ACTIVITY IN AN ORGAN OF A SUBJECT, PREFERABLY IN THE SMALL INTESTINE OR THE DUODENUM
The present disclosure provides, according to some embodiments, methods and systems for selectively reducing, blocking or inhibiting at least part of the neural activity in an organ of a subject. In preferred embodiments, the method and system are used for selectively blocking at least part of the neural activity in a duodenum of a subject in need thereof. According to some embodiments, the selective blocking occurs through use of laser radiation. According to some embodiments, the selective blocking occurs through use of ultrasound energy. According to some embodiments, the selective blocking comprises causing damage to at least part of sensory nerves located within a target area while maintaining functional activity of tissue surrounding the sensory nerves by means of shielding it from the effects of laser radiation. According to some embodiments, the sensory nerves include neurons configured to transmit signals triggered by food passing through the duodenum, such as, but not limited to, neurohormonal signals.
METHOD AND APPARATUS FOR TOOTH BODY AUTOMATIC PREPARATION BY DIGITAL CONTROLLED LASER LIGHT AND TOOTH RETAINER
A digital control laser automatic tooth preparation method and device and a tooth positioner are provided. The device includes an intra-oral three-dimensional scanner, a dental laser, an oral working end of a digital control laser tooth preparation control system, an oral and maxillofacial cone beam CT scanner, a computer, a tooth positioner, a negative-pressure suction device and a real-time monitoring device. The computer is connected respectively with the intra-oral three-dimensional scanner, the dental laser, the oral working end of the digital control laser tooth preparation control system, the oral and maxillofacial cone beam CT scanner, the negative-pressure suction device, and the real-time monitoring device. The dental laser is connected with the oral working end of the digital control laser tooth preparation control system through a light guiding arm (1). The oral working end of the digital control laser tooth preparation control system is connected with the tooth positioner and the real-time monitoring device. The negative-pressure suction device is connected with the tooth positioner. The digital control laser automatic tooth preparation method and device according to embodiments of the present invention can replace part of manual operations of a doctor, uses a laser to replace a conventional mechanical grinding instrument, and can effectively improve the standard level and efficiency of clinical oral tooth preparation.
